In 1905, Nikiforov joined the Itinerants. Despite the fact that he was haunted by an inferiority complex all his life, he actively exhibited his works at traveling exhibitions. Having a strong will and passionately feeling the thirst for life, this man took on any problem, without calculating his own strength. He wanted to be a titan, performing great feats, to fight with the help of art against all sorts of negative manifestations of life. And as a result, he worked at the limit of his body’s physiological capabilities, subjecting his weak nervous system to strain. Which is why he often ended up in hospitals. Nevertheless, when he was advised to take care of his health in order to preserve his vitality for the sake of further service to art, he mostly laughed it off. And if they directly said that he was driving himself into the grave ahead of time by overexerting himself at work, Nikiforov would answer that “a raven lives for two hundred years, but feeds on carrion, and it is better to fall immediately in battle than to drag out a long rigmarole of useless calm.”

This was the artist’s life credo, which he never violated and proved with his whole life, having lived only thirty-five years.

In 1909, Semyon Gavrilovich’s heart began to work intermittently. Asphyxiation attacks appeared more and more often. The artist went to Crimea for treatment, and then to Italy. But the vaunted favorable climate and famous doctors did not help. At the end of 1911, Nikiforov visited his beloved Sazhnevo for the last time, and on February 25, 1912, he died in Moscow.

In 1985, when the current children’s tourist center “Silver Prudy” was being created on the site of the boarding school for children with speech defects that had previously existed in Sazhnevo, the walls of Nikiforov’s art studio that had still been preserved were destroyed. In which the artist’s most famous paintings were born – “Prasol”, “Women”, “The Storm is Coming”, “Arrived”. Now the works of Semyon Nikiforov are in the State Museum of Arts of Uzbekistan, in Perm, Sevastopol, and also in the Tretyakov Gallery. His paintings are also in the Ryazan Regional Art Museum.
